Some military operations that help stabilize or continue the operations of the governing body or civil structure of a foreign country are:
Stability operations: These focus on supporting the political, economic, and social functions of a government to maintain order and stability.
Peacekeeping operations: These involve the deployment of military forces to help maintain peace, protect civilians, and facilitate the transition to a stable government in conflict or post-conflict zones.
Capacity-building operations: These aim to enhance the capabilities of the local government and institutions, such as providing training and assistance to strengthen their ability to govern effectively and provide essential services to the population.
